Description
"When ten-year-old Katie O'Brien and her little brother arrive in Omaha, Nebraska, in 1882 on the "Orphan Train," they are tragically split up between two different families. Mrs. Neal picks Katie and eventually takes Katie to Denver where she has acquired a job caring for a well-known black woman, Aunt Clara Brown. The story shares many of Katie's extraordinary experiences: making a Christmas tree out of tumbleweeds, tasting her first ice cream soda, meeting her first Indian, and learning to ride a new invention--the bicycle. The best thing that happens to Katie, though, is finding a new home with people who love and care about her"--Cover, P. [4].
